Seriously, we are not Japan. They were already used to very low yields on savings and were still big savers, rather than borrower-spenders, so low rates stimulated nothing. Low rates here, OTOH, created a refi boom and the result is increased discretionary spending capacity that will be reflected in coming months and years.
